Brother Patrice NGOY MUSOKO +243999923927 Is a Congolese musician and president of the "My Soul Praises the Eternal" Foundation, which includes the following areas: Education Department (A School) Social Department (An Orphanage) Music Department (An Orchestra, a Mother and Child Department) He was born into a family of four children. Jonathan MBESE (JONAS to his close friends), NGIAMA MAKANDA (WERRASON), and NGITUKA Guy are his brothers, all married. His parents are MUSOKO THEO and MUKALA Albertine. He is from MOLIAMBO, Kilunda Chiefdom, Bulungu Territory, Kwilu District, Bandundu Province. He is married to Mrs. Esther Mukombo Kimvangu and is the father of five children: four boys and one girl. His realization that he had a calling from God in the field of music began as follows: His father was a servant of God and always invited his children to accompany him to church. His father regularly sang hymns with his children and was always the first to arrive at church. One day, Brother Patrice asked his father, "Who is God? Why should people worship Him? And why does God love praise and worship?" It was the answers to these questions that inspired Brother Patrice to serve God through music. And when the Lord took his father, Brother Patrice continued to serve God through song: He formed many choirs in the Bandundu province, namely in Moliambo, at the Kimbinga Mission, and at CBCO Kenge. Then he adopted the Griot style, and today he is the president of his own group, "My Soul Praises the Lord."
